    We are staying in POR in a couple of weeks. I would like to request to be near the action..restaurant, main pool, arcade, laundry etc. If I have reserved a regular room and request one of the Preferred rooms when we check in, will I get charged extra?

    Hi Heidi,

    You are welcome to ask for a preferred room upon check-in.  However, if you make the request to upgrade, you will likely be charged the difference between a standard and a preferred room. Sometimes, through the forces of pixie dust and good luck, guests who booked standard rooms are upgraded to preferred rooms.  It's not always clearly why this happens but I have heard that it may be due to a shortage of unoccupied standard rooms.  If that happens, you get the preferred room without having to pay the up-charge.  It's a long-shot, but I'll keep my fingers crossed that this happens to you. 

    If you don't want to book a preferred room in advance, my best advice to you would be to ask politely at the front desk if there are any complimentary room upgrades available.  While it is unlikely that this will be the case, it never hurts to ask. 

    Meanwhile, add a request to your hotel reservation stating that you wish to be placed as close as possible to Sassagoula Steamboat Company and the River Mill food court.  That's where you'll find most of the resort's amenities.
